/* 
 *  standard unix version of launch:
 *  adapted from the system() code in:
 *  W. Richard Stevens
 *  "Advanced Programming in the Unix Environment" 
 *  Addison-Wesley Publishing Co, 1992
 *  p. 314
 */
#ifdef ANSI_FUNC
static int launch_fork_exec(char *cmdstring, int attach, 
			    char **stdfiles, int *pipes)
#else
  static int launch_fork_exec(cmdstring, attach, stdfiles, pipes)
     char *cmdstring;
     int attach;
     char **stdfiles;
     int *pipes;
#endif
{
  int status;
  int tpipes[4];
  struct sigaction ignore, saveintr, savequit;
  sigset_t chldmask, savemask;
#if LAUNCH_USE_PIPE
  int fd[2];
#endif

  /* return false if no command is specified */
  if( !cmdstring || !*cmdstring ) return -1;

  ignore.sa_handler = SIG_IGN;	/* ignore SIGINT and SIGQUIT */
  sigemptyset(&ignore.sa_mask);
  ignore.sa_flags = 0;
  if (sigaction(SIGINT, &ignore, &saveintr) < 0)
    return -1;
  if (sigaction(SIGQUIT, &ignore, &savequit) < 0)
    return -1;
  
  sigemptyset(&chldmask);	/* now block SIGCHLD */
  sigaddset(&chldmask, SIGCHLD);
  if (sigprocmask(SIG_BLOCK, &chldmask, &savemask) < 0)
    return -1;
  
#if LAUNCH_USE_PIPE
  /* open a pipe so parent can hear if the child fails to exec */
  if( !attach ){
    if( pipe(fd) < 0 )
      return -1;
    xfcntl(fd[0], F_SETFD, FD_CLOEXEC);
    xfcntl(fd[1], F_SETFD, FD_CLOEXEC);
  }
#endif

  /* create temp ipc pipes if necessary */
  if( pipes ){
    if( launch_pipes(tpipes, 0) < 0 ) return -1;
  }

  /* start new process */
  if( (pid = fork()) < 0 ){
#if LAUNCH_USE_PIPE
    if( !attach ){
      close(fd[0]);
      close(fd[1]);
    }
#endif
    if( pipes ){
      close(tpipes[0]);
      close(tpipes[1]);
      close(tpipes[2]);
      close(tpipes[3]);
    }
    status = -1;		/* ERROR: probably out of processes */
  } else if( pid == 0 ){	/* child */
    int i, j, len;
    char *argv[LAUNCH_ARGS+1];
    char *path=NULL;
    char *s=NULL, *t=NULL;

    /* reset pipes, if necessary */
    if( pipes ){
      /* close parent's read/write pipes */
      close(tpipes[0]);
      close(tpipes[3]);
      /* change child's stdin/stdout to use the passed pipes to parent */
      dup2(tpipes[2], 0);  close(tpipes[2]);
      dup2(tpipes[1], 1);  close(tpipes[1]);
    }

    /* close and reopen stdio files, if necessary */
    if( stdfiles ){
      for(i=0; i<3; i++){
	if( stdfiles[i] ){
	  close(i);
	  switch(i){
	  case 0:
	    if( open(stdfiles[i], O_RDONLY) < 0){
	      _exit(-1);
	    }
	    break;
	  case 1:
	    if( open(stdfiles[i], O_CREAT|O_WRONLY|O_TRUNC, 0600) < 0){
	      _exit(-1);
	    }
	    break;
	  case 2:
	    /* if stderr is the same as stdout, just dup */
	    if( stdfiles[1] && !strcmp(stdfiles[1], stdfiles[i]) ){
	      dup(1);
	    }
	    else{
	      if( open(stdfiles[i], O_CREAT|O_WRONLY|O_TRUNC, 0600) < 0){
		_exit(-1);
	      }
	    }
	    break;
	  }
	}
      }
    }

    /* restore previous signal actions & reset signal mask, but only if
       parent is waiting for completion (i.e., we are "attached") */
    if( attach ){
      sigaction(SIGINT, &saveintr, NULL);
      sigaction(SIGQUIT, &savequit, NULL);
      sigprocmask(SIG_SETMASK, &savemask, NULL);
    }
#if LAUNCH_USE_PIPE
    /* child closes reader -- only writes status */
    else{
      close(fd[0]);
    }
#endif

    /* package up the arguments for new process */
    t = (char *)xstrdup(cmdstring);
    for(i=0, s=(char *)strtok(t, " \t"); s;
	i++, s=(char *)strtok(NULL," \t")){
      if( i < LAUNCH_ARGS ){ 
	/* save argument */
	argv[i] = xstrdup(s);
	/* change back special char to spaces, if necessary */
	len = strlen(argv[i]);
	for(j=0; j<len; j++){
	  if( argv[i][j] == LAUNCH_SPACE){
	    argv[i][j] = ' ';
	  }
	}
	argv[i+1] = NULL;
	/* save program name */
	if( i == 0 ) path = argv[i];
      }
    }
    if( t ) xfree(t);
#ifndef HAVE_CYGWIN
    /* this call is broken in cygwin */
    /* for unattached processes, start a new session (with new process id),
       so that we do not inherit signals from parent (particularly SIGTERM) */
    if( !attach )
      setsid();
#endif
    /* start up the new program */
    if( execvp(path, argv) ){
      status = 127;
#if LAUNCH_USE_PIPE
      if( !attach ){
	write(fd[1], &status, 4);
	close(fd[1]);
      }
#endif
      _exit(status);		/* exec error */
    }
  } else {			/* parent */
    /* wait for program termination from attached process */
    if( attach ){
      while( waitpid(pid, &status, 0) < 0 ){
	if( xerrno != EINTR ){
	  status = -1; /* error other than EINTR from waitpid() */
	  break;
	}
      }
    }
    else{
#if LAUNCH_USE_WAITPID
      status = launch_waitstart(pid);
#endif
#if LAUNCH_USE_PIPE
      close(fd[1]);
      if( read(fd[0], &status, 4) == 0 ){
	status = 0;
      }
      close(fd[0]);
#endif
    }
  }
  
  /* cleanup temp ipc pipes and move into user space */
  if( pipes ){
    cleanup_pipes(tpipes);
    pipes[0] = tpipes[0];
    pipes[1] = tpipes[1];
  }

  /* restore previous signal actions & reset signal mask */
  if( sigaction(SIGINT, &saveintr, NULL) < 0 )        return -1;
  if( sigaction(SIGQUIT, &savequit, NULL) < 0 )       return -1;
  if( sigprocmask(SIG_SETMASK, &savemask, NULL) < 0 ) return -1;
  
  /* return the news */
  return status;
}
